Probleme beim Artikelbestand

Thema wurde von pulli#7, 15. Oktober 2018 erstellt.

  1.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Hallo,

    habe ein Problem bei den Artikelbeständen:

    - Testartikel ist in zwei Varianten lieferbar. Geregelt über Eigenschaften. Bestand beider Eigenschaften 2 Stück. In den Eigenschaften-Einstellungen ist die Bestandsprüfung auf Kombinationsbestand eingestellt.

    Folgendes Szenario:
    -Bestellung Variante 2 mit Stückzahl 2. Der normale Artikelbestand bleibt auf 0 (was ja auch richtig ist, da ja die Variante bzw. Kombination geprüft und abgezogen werden soll). In den Eigenschaften steht Variante 2 nun beim Bestand auf 0 und Variante 1 auf 2.
    - Weitere Bestellung Variante 1 mit Stückzahl 1. Habe ich nun bei den Lagerverwaltungs-Optionen es so eingestellt, das der Artikel auf inaktiv gesetzt wird, wenn der nicht mehr lieferbar ist, springt der Artikel schon jetzt auf inaktiv. Variante 1 ist aber noch mit Stückzahl 1 im Eigenschaftsbestand.

    Nur wenn ich bei den Lagerverwaltungs-Optionen den Haken bei Artikel inaktiv setzen rausnehme funktioniert es richtig. Leider natürlich mit dem Ergebnis, das der Artikel immer als vorrätig und aktiv angezeigt wird, auch wenn der Kombinationsbestand bei allen Varianten auf 0 ist.

    Wo liegt hier der Fehler ?

    Noch ein Nachtrag:
    Getestet habe ich dies, da es bei einem Kundenshop dieses Problem gibt. Interessanterweise wird da bei einigen Artikeln auch der "normale" Artikelbestand abgezogen, auch wenn dieser eigentlich auf 0 steht und es einen Eigenschaftsbestand gibt.

    Woran kann das liegen ? Wenn ein Bestand in den Eigenschaften vorhanden ist sollte hier doch nur der Bestand abgezogen werden und nicht der "normale" Artikelbestand oder ?

    Oder muss bei dem normalen Bestand die Gesamtzahl der Kombinationsbestände eingetragen werden ??

    Ich bin verwirrt... :(
     
  2.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Du musst dem Artikel auch einen Bestand geben, nicht nur der Eigenschaft.
     
  3.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Oh in Ordnung, das wusste ich nicht. Da trage ich also die Summe der Eigenschaftsbestände ein richtig ?

    Denn bei meinem Testartikel in meinem Shop wird der "normale" Artikelbestand nicht geändert, wenn Varianten abverkauft werden. Der bleibt schön auf 0.

    Beim Kunden ändert sich der "normale" Bestand interessanterweise schon.
     
  4.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Könnte an der Shopversion liegen.
    Ich meine, bis 3.8 wurde der Artikelbestand nciht abgezogen, ab 3.10 dann aber schon.
    Ich hatte überall bei Varianten einen Bestand von 999, dadurch konnte ich in der Übersicht gleich sehen, das es sich um einen Varianten-Artikel handelt.
    Aber seit 3.10 schrumpfte die Zahl.
     
  5.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Hmmm...eigentlich sollte es anders sein, denn ich habe 3.10. Da schrumpft es nicht, Kunde hat 3.8. Da schrumpft es aber...

    Oh man das verwirrt mich nur noch mehr... :(
     
  6.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Kann auch sein, dass es mit 3.8 kam... ihc habe nur irgendwann gesehen, dass ich keine 999 mehr habe.:)

    Ich weiß nicht ob es ins minus zählt, wenn Artikel mit Bestand 0 nicht gekauft werden können.
    Hast Du denn Artikel, die einen bestand haben und Eigenschaften?
     
  7.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Also ich selbst nicht. Da habe ich es nur mit einem Testartikel gemacht.

    Beim Kunden war es so, das der "normale" Artikelbestand immer auf 0 stand. Die eigentlichen Bestände hatte der Kunde in seinem Shop bei den Eigenschaften eingetragen. Allerdings habe ich jetzt gesehen, das er da teilweise in den Einstellungen nicht den Kombinationsbestand sondern die Standard-Einstellung hinterlegt hatte.

    Und da wurden dann teilweise (kann es leider nicht mehr ganz genau rekonstruiren) der Bestand auch schon mal auf unter 0 gestellt.
     
  8.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Das erklärt den Unterschied.

    Du solltest das bei Dir mal testen, mit dem Bestand., das kann bei mir auch immer mal durch eigene Anpassungen anders sein, als bei anderen :)
     
  9.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Also habe es jetzt nochmal direkt im Kundenshop mit einem Testartikel getestet.

    Folgende Varianten habe ich probiert:
    1. "normaler" Artikelbestand = Summe der Kombinationsbestände. Bei den Eigenschaften als Einstellung bei der Bestandsprüfung = Standard.

    Ergebnis: Es werden sowohl der "normale" als auch der Kombinationsbestand abgezogen. So weit auch richtig. Das einzige was nicht so ganz passt ist, das sich der "normale" Bestand nach Löschen einer Bestellung trotz setzen des Hakens nicht ändert. Aber gut, das müsste man per Hand dann erledigen.

    2. "normaler" Artikelbestand = 0. Bei den Eigenschaften der Einstellung Bestandsprüfung = Kombinationsbestand.

    Ergebnis: Funktioniert nicht ganz korrekt. Habe 2 Größen mit je 2 Stück angelegt. Nun habe ich eine Bestellung ausgeführt (Größe 1 = 2x). Nachdem ich dann eine zweite Bestellung mit Größe 2 = 1x durchgeführt hatte wurde der Artikel auf "inaktiv" gesetzt. Obwohl ja noch 1x die Größe 2 bei den Kombinationen vorhanden ist.

    End-Ergebnis: Alles nicht so wirklich befriedigend. Habe dem Kunden nun aber Variante 1 empfohlen, da es hier im Normalfall zumindest richtig läuft. Sollten mal Bestellungen gelöscht oder storniert werden muss der Artikel wohl oder über nochmal händisch kontrolliert und notfalls angepasst werden.
     
  10. barbara
    barbara G-WARD 2014-2020
    Registriert seit:
    14. August 2011
    Beiträge:
    35.657
    Danke erhalten:
    11.371
    Danke vergeben:
    1.616
    Und wenn Du die 3. Variante nimmst?

    Artikelbestand = Summer der Eigenschaften
    Einstellung in den Eigenschaften -> Bestandsprüfung = Kombinationsbestand
     
  11. pulli#7
    pulli#7 Erfahrener Benutzer
    Registriert seit:
    13. Oktober 2017
    Beiträge:
    299
    Danke erhalten:
    53
    Danke vergeben:
    76
    Dann bleibt der normale Bestand interessanterweise immer gleich und nur der Kombinationsbestand schrumpft. Nach einer Bestellung stimmen dann halt normaler Bestand und Summe der Kombinationsbestände nicht mehr überein.

    Der Artikel ist dann immer sichtbar (da er nicht inaktiv gesetzt wird), aber es kommt die Meldung, das diese Kombination nicht vorrätig ist. Auch nicht optimal.

    Daher ist meiner Meinung nach nur Variante 1 wirklich praktikabel. Lediglich wenn mal eine Bestellung gelöscht wird (was hoffentlich nicht oft vorkommt) muss man händisch den Lieferstatus, den Artikelstatus und die "normale" Anzahl wieder eintragen, bzw. eventuell korrigieren.

    Denn komischerweise wird das trotz setzen des Hakens beim Löschen nicht beachtet.

    Habe das soeben nochmal probiert. Wenn ich "Artikelanzahl dem Lager gutschreiben" anklicke wird zwar der Kombinationsbestand wieder korrigiert, aber nicht der "normale" Artikelbestand.

    Und auch die Häkchen bei "Lieferstatus neu berechnen" und "Artikelstatus zurücksetzen" haben bei meinen Tests nicht dazu geführt, das sich diese Staten (oder wie ist die Mehrzahl von Status) ändert.